我们有一个DLL(一个COM服务器)可以在32位和64位编译,但DLL使用相同的CLSID和AppID 32位版本和64位版本.这样可以,还是必须改变?
我问这个是因为显然在64位机器上,我们无法将32位版本和64位版本注册在一起.如果32位客户端应用程序可以自动使用32位DLL,并且64位客户端应用程序可以自动使用64位DLL,那将是很好的.
在相关的说明中,我们有客户端应用程序的源代码和Visual Studio 2005项目文件...我们如何编译同一应用程序的32位和64位版本?它是一个C#应用程序,它包含对我们的COM服务器DLL的引用,如下所示:
<ItemGroup> <COMReference Include="ComServer">
<Guid>{C1FADEA6-68FD-4F43-9FC2-0BC451FA5D53}</Guid>
<VersionMajor>830</VersionMajor> <VersionMinor>0</VersionMinor>
<Lcid>0</Lcid> <WrapperTool>tlbimp</WrapperTool> <Isolated>False</Isolated>
</COMReference> </ItemGroup>
如果事实证明我们需要一个单独的64位CLSID,我们如何在Visual Studio中"仅针对32位配置"进行此引用?或者我们必须有相同的源代码的单独项目:一个引用32位DLL,另一个引用64位DLL?
我在Windows 7 IIS上使用WordPress进行开发.我正在WordPress中上传图片以获取博文.图像在网站上显示正常,但是一旦启用固定链接,图像就不再有效,并且未来的任何图像上传我都会收到错误:
HTTP Error 500.50 - URL Rewrite Module Error.
The page cannot be displayed because an internal server error has occurred.
Run Code Online (Sandbox Code Playgroud)
我不知道为什么会发生这种情况,这是我的web.config:
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="wordpress" patternSyntax="Wildcard">
<match url="*" />
<conditions>
<add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true" />
<add input="{REQUEST_FILENAME}" matchType="IsDirectory" negate="true" />
</conditions>
<action type="Rewrite" url="index.php"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
Run Code Online (Sandbox Code Playgroud)
一旦我关闭我的永久链接并使用默认它有效,有谁知道为什么这可能?
我正在研究一个项目,它要求我计算从变量点A到0到360度的变量点B的航向,让A点的物体面向B点.
现在,我不确定如何实现这一点,我用谷歌搜索,但没有找到任何好的解决方案.
在任何情况下,如何计算2D空间中从A点到B点的航向?
我有一个悬停效果的图像(当鼠标悬停在它上面时,不透明度更高).当鼠标移入和移出时,它可以根据需要工作.
但是,图像本身正在移动(我会定期更改css属性顶部).当鼠标不移动并且图像在鼠标光标下移动时,不会触发相关事件.这意味着,不会调用悬停函数.我也试过使用mouseenter和mouseleave事件,但它们也不起作用.
什么是获得所需行为的好方法(鼠标悬停在图像上时悬停效果,无论它到达何处)?
丑陋:
string city = null;
if (myOrder != null && myOrder.Customer != null)
city = myOrder.Customer.City;
Run Code Online (Sandbox Code Playgroud)
更好(也许是monad):
var city = myOrder
.With(x => x.Customer)
.With(x => x.City)
Run Code Online (Sandbox Code Playgroud)
更好的?有什么理由不能写吗?
var city = Maybe(() => myOrder.Customer.City);
Run Code Online (Sandbox Code Playgroud) 我从几个消息来源获悉,在数据库中存储XML是"糟糕的",但我从未见过/听到过为什么会这样做的实际解释.这是真的吗?如果是真的,你能解释一下原因吗?而且,你能告诉我在数据库中存储XML的"好"案例是什么?
有点像"灯箱2"效果,但仅限于鼠标指向的元素.我甚至不知道如何开始.任何建议都很棒,谢谢.
我有一个包含图像的文件夹,只能使用 HTTPS 访问该文件夹。如何将所有请求从 HTTP 重定向到 HTTPS?
我做模数错了吗?因为在Java -13 % 64中应该评估,-13但我得到51.